Аннотация:The unique and reiterated sequences of DNA of 7 species of Lepidoptera, cock-roach and a dragonfly were compared by means of molecular hybridization. Hybridization of 3H-labelled fraction of reiterated DNA sequences of Portetria dispar with the DNA of P. monacha showed 51% of homology, and with Bombyx mori DNA - 20% homology. Hybridization in permissive conditions revealed approximately twice as much homologies in the DNA compared. The three-fold increase in amount of nucleotide substitutions was observed. The thermostability of heteroduplexes correlates with homology levels. The fractions of unique DNA sequences of P. dispar is less homologous to DNA of other Lepidoptera species (13-46%). Interorder DNA hybridization of unique and reiterated fractions revealed 4-8% of homology.
